Default 929 Ram air ducts!

I have never seen anyone else with these so I thought I'd post 'em. They're good for another 5-7 hp and it took me about 20min to install! I like the way you can't even see them unless you are really looking. I also bought some black polyehtylene screen and epoxied it in place as intake guards. My 929 breaths a lot easier with them on - it does seem like I clean the air filter a lot but it's probably cause I'm meticulous about it.

Default RE: 929 Ram air ducts!

had the exact same thing on my 929 when I bought it. used elbows from a gutter system with the screen expoxied on the inside. Used dryer ducting (or something very similar, flexible metal tubing) to route to the 2 rubber tubes feeding the airbox.

Rubbed the forks and rattled badly. I yanked em out asap.

Default RE: 929 Ram air ducts!

These aren't made from gutter (although I have seen those too). These are hand laid fiberglass units and they fit perfectly. I got them from hardracing.com a few years back. I don't think they have them on the website anymore but call them or email and I'll bet they can still get them...
